U&I Software has updated the MetaSynth composition and sound design software for Mac OS X to version 5.31, adding full OS X Lion compatibility as well as powerful new spectral processing features and other refinements.
MetaSynth is a revolutionary electronic music and sound design environment. It is not a soft synth but a full-fledged sound design and electronic music studio.
Changes in MetaSynth v5.31
- SO Filters: The new Second Order Filters (in the Effects Room) implement combinations of high-quality peak, bandpass, high-pass and low-pass filters.
- New Spectrum Synth Capabilities: A number of new capabilities were added to the Spectrum Synth Room. The new Apply Image Filter command allows color images to be applied to Spectrum Synth sequences to provide dynamic stereo envelopes. This capability enables the creation of rich sounds with complex, dynamic frequency-based stereo movement. New commands provide complex compositing of clipboard spectrum data with sequence events to create amazing sound morphs.
- Many Other Refinements: The new release features numerous useful refinements, bug fixes and full OS X Lion compatibility.
MetaSynth for Mac is available to purchase for $599 USD. MetaSynth 5.31 is a free update to users of MetaSynth 5. Upgrades are available to users of previous versions of MetaSynth. Cockos has updated its Reaper music production software for Windows and Mac to version 4.20.
REAPER is digital audio workstation software: a complete multitrack audio and MIDI recording, editing, processing, mixing, and mastering environment.
Changes in Reaper 4.20
- OSC control surface support for integration with hardware/software that supports Open Sound Control.
- Localization/translation, use languages other than English within REAPER.
- MIDI bus support allows sending more than 16 channels of MIDI to a ReWire device, and more.
- Countless usability improvements, bugfixes, and minor performance enhancements.
The full changelog and upgrade instructions are available on the Reaper download page.
Reaper for Windows and Mac is available to purchase for $225 USD (full commercial license) / $60 USD (discounted license).

Propellerhead Software has updated ReCycle, a creative tool for total sample and loop control.
ReCycle 2.2 is a free update that brings is 64-bit compatibility, is Mac OS X Lion compatible, and has a new look and some workflow improvements.
Changes in ReCycle v2.2
- The program is now compatible with 64 bit operating systems.
- ReCyle 2.2 is also a true Cocoa program under Mac OS and fully compatible with Mac OS X 10.7 Lion. ReCycle 2.2 requires a Mac with an Intel processor. PowerPC is no longer supported.
- The main window has been graphically redesigned, including new zooming and scrolling. Scrolling is smoother and you can now zoom in further. Some redundant controls have been removed and others added.
- When exporting AIFF and Wave files, Record/Reason-style tempo information is now included in the file. Also, when importing audio files created in Record or Reason, the tempo information in those files is used for setting tempo and length in ReCycle.
- The Waveform now indicates graphically what sound will be played back, by dimming silent sections.
- You can now use the Q, W, E and R keys to select tools.
- The max length of audio files you can edit in ReCycle is no longer limited to five minutes.
- New online help on Mac and Windows.
- The Preference dialog has been streamlined and updated.
- Open Recent (documents) is now a sub-menu on Mac OS.
- The status bar has been removed.
- We have removed support for the Sound Designer II, Mixman and SampleCell formats since these are all outdated.
- The authorization system and copy protection has been changed, reducing the risk of having to reauthorize the program.
- Installation under Mac OS is now drag and drop (no installer).
ReCycle for Windows and Mac is available to purchase for 229 EUR. The 2.2 update is now available to download for registered users.

Steinberg has announced the release of the Steinberg Elements Pack, a bundle comprising Cubase Elements 6 and WaveLab Elements 7, providing all the essential tools that make recording, editing, mixing and mastering music on a PC and Mac computer a rewarding experience.
Cubase Elements 6 features 33 audio effect processors, including Pitch Correct for correcting vocal intonation automatically. With its Groove Agent ONE for producing beats and rhythms as well as the Prologue synthesizer and HALion Sonic SE, Cubase Elements 6 has more than 550 instruments and sounds to supercharge the user’s creativity.
WaveLab Elements 7 comes with an array of VST 3 plug-ins such as StudioEQ and VST Dynamics, superbly complemented by a premium restoration suite by Sonnox, consisting of DeNoiser, DeBuzzer and DeClicker. Also new in the entry-level version of WaveLab are the burning engine and its extensive podcast functionalities.
The Steinberg Elements Pack is available until the end of this year as download and boxed version through the Steinberg Online Shop, for a suggested retail price of 149 EUR including German VAT.

Steinberg has announced that its Steinberg LE Pack SAE Edition is available as welcome profile package for more than 1,600 first-semester students of 26 SAE Institutes across Europe.
The pack comprises light editions of the Cubase 6 music production software and WaveLab 7 audio editing software.
“It is eminently important to us that our students learn the established methods and tools of trade. Steinberg’s software most certainly falls into that category. We are therefore pleased that our audio engineer students now receive the Steinberg LE Pack SAE Edition here in Europe. Especially Cubase, with its many flexible tools, is suitable for the different working methods and helps our students make good use of their creativity in the production process, right from the start,” commented Rüdi Grieme, director of operations for SAE Europe.
“Steinberg greatly appreciates this cooperation with an important — if not the most important — institution educating in new creative technologies,” remarked Frank Simmerlein, director of marketing at Steinberg.
Cubase LE 6 features
- Based on the award-winning 32-bit floating-point Steinberg audio engine, the Cubase LE 6 music production software supports up to 24 MIDI tracks, eight instrument tracks, 16 audio tracks and eight physical inputs simultaneously in 24-bit and 96 kHz audio quality.
- Boasting the HALion Sonic SE workstation instrument with full GM compatibility and over 180 instrument presets, Cubase LE 6 offers an array of audio and MIDI recording, editing and mixing tools plus 16 effect processors.
- Other highlights include score editing, real-time pitch-shifting and time-stretching capabilities, the MediaBay content management tool and the Project Assistant with dozens of templates for quick and easy setup.
WaveLab LE 7 features
- With up to 96 kHz sample rate and 32-bit resolution, the 2-track WaveLab LE 7 audio editing and mastering tool provides a range of audio plug-ins based on the latest version of Virtual Studio Technology (VST).
- Its flexible window architecture allows the user to reorganize the windows for efficient usability.
- Also available in WaveLab LE 7 are extensive podcast and publishing options plus an audio CD grabbing tool for extracting audio tracks from music CDs to many popular formats.
On October 13–14, 2011, Steinberg is exhibiting its latest products at the seventh SAE Alumni Convention at the SAE Berlin.
Steinberg LE Pack SAE Edition is available in the SAE Profile Packs for first-semester students of the SAE in 26 institutions across Europe. An upgrade from the Steinberg LE Pack SAE Edition to Cubase Elements 6 and WaveLab Elements 7 is available in Europe through the SAE student store for EUR 49 including German VAT. Pricing may vary for other countries.

Kenaxis Creative has updated the Mac version of Kenaxis, a real-time audio performance application.
KENAXIS the new crossroads of: composition and free improvisation, inspiration and innovation, live performance and your sound library, chaos and control
Changes in Kenaxis v3.3
- Added Multitrack Record: This is very useful if you want to remix material you create while using Kenaxis. You can now create separate stereo files for each of the Kenaxis objects such as the Klangs, Granulators and Freeze when recording.
- SoftStep Support: If you own a Keith McMillen SoftStep, Kenaxis is now optimized to use it. It’s set up to use the LEDs and display on the SoftStep so that not only is the SoftStep an input device but it shows the status of Kenaxis as well.
- Sync Klangs 2-5 to Klang 1: You can now automatically sync live loop recordings done in Klangs 2-6 to the length of your loop in Klang 1.
- New manual that covers all of the additions to Kenaxis (Check it out for more information on the new additions).
- Value Randomizer Prefs added to customize how a random impulse works (Command E).
- Fixed Kenaxis Visualizer link.
- Fixed System Prefs bugs.
Kenaxis is available to purchase for lowered price of $49 USD. An update for Kenaxis on Windows PC will be available soon.
